### Alfresco Repositories APS configuration
|
||||
|
||||
APS allows you to configure where to store files and folders in your on-site Alfresco repositories.
|
||||
|
||||
If you have your repositories configured like this, you can use the attach file/folder
|
||||
form widget to get a file from those repositories and attach it to the Form.
|
||||
|
||||
**Note:** your repositories could be configured to be on different servers from the one
|
||||
where your front-end is deployed. Make sure you are using the right Proxy or configuration,
|
||||
otherwise you will get a cross-origin resource sharing (CORS) error.
|
||||
|
||||
Also, don't forget to set the `providers` property to `ALL` in the `app.config.json` login configuration:
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
"providers": "ALL",
|
||||
```
